DSPE-PEG 2000
Based on 15 publication(s) in Google Scholar
DSPE-PEG 2000 is a PEG polymer containing DSPE and amine end groups. DSPE-PEG 2000 can be used to form micelles as nanoparticles for drug delivery.

Guidelines (Following is our recommended protocol. This protocol only provides a guideline, and should be modified according to your specific needs).
Reparation of siRNALNPs[2]:
1.DSPE-PEG2000 (0.11 mg) in chloroform (3 mL), and transfer the lipid solution to a round bottom flask after ultrasonic treatment to fully dissolve it.
2.Steam under vacuum conditions for 30 min (75 r/min, room temperature) to allow the organic solvent to completely evaporate and obtain a homogeneous lipid film.
3.Hydrate with 3 mL of enzyme free water for 10 min (100 r/min) and then homogenize with ultrasound.
4.siRNA solution was mixed with LNPs by electrostatic interaction at a weight ratio of 1:30, and concentrated by centrifugation in a Macrosep Advance filtration device (MAP001C37) (3000g/min, 4 °C).
5.The molecular weight was cut off to 10 kDa to remove the unsealed drug.

Lösungsmittel & Löslichkeit
DMSO : 50 mg/mL (Need ultrasonic; Hygroscopic DMSO has a significant impact on the solubility of product, please use newly opened DMSO)
Ethanol : 25 mg/mL (ultrasonic and warming and heat to 60°C)
H2O : 25 mg/mL (ultrasonic and warming and heat to 60°C)

Add each solvent one by one: 10% DMSO 40% PEG300 5% Tween-80 45% Saline
Solubility: ≥ 2.5 mg/mL; Clear solution
This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.5 mg/mL (saturation unknown).
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(25.0 mg/mL) to 400 μL PEG300, and mix evenly; then add 50 μL Tween-80 and mix evenly; then add 450 μL Saline to adjust the volume to 1 mL.
Preparation of Saline: Dissolve 0.9 g sodium chloride in ddH₂O and dilute to 100 mL to obtain a clear Saline solution.
Add each solvent one by one: 10% DMSO 90% (20% SBE-β-CD in Saline)
Solubility: ≥ 2.5 mg/mL; Clear solution
This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.5 mg/mL (saturation unknown).
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(25.0 mg/mL) to 900 μL 20% SBE-β-CD in Saline, and mix evenly.
Preparation of 20% SBE-β-CD in Saline (4°C, storage for one week): 2 g SBE-β-CD powder is dissolved in 10 mL Saline, completely dissolve until clear.
